Default Traction Control/Tranny

Well I had to take a trip to Laramie this weekend and on the way there we had to stop and wait for construction. While waiting on the flagger to let us go the Service Traction Control message popped up, shut down the car and restarted to see if it'd clear, nope, still there. While driving with the message on the car was shifting awkwardly. It'd shift hard no matter what speed/throttle but about half a second after the shift it would act like a clutch was engaged for a moment causing lose of acceleration before picking up again. Had about 20 miles to the next town so got there and got gas and checked tranny fluid and oil, both normal and fine. Once we got back on the road the message never came back on and the car started shifting fine again.

Any ideas? I was thinking it must be something in the computer and when the car was shut of for gas it was long enough that the computer cleared and reprogrammed that little bit that messed up.

Hmm....IDK. Weird. Sounds computer related to me too though!

If your car is still under warrenty, I would take in ASAP.....Even though the message went away, the car still stores the code for a while, so the dealer would be able to see exactly what the code was, and why it was happening...It could be the start of a traction control problem, or tranny problem...
